Be Flexible on Timing
Disney World started using “dynamic pricing” in 2018, meaning it charges higher prices during holidays and popular weeks and lower prices for off-peak visits. In general, you’ll find the lowest pricing in late August and early September, and for weekday visits to the parks. The kids are back in school by August, so the parks are less crowded and the prices are lower. Weather-wise, it’s a hotter time of year, but if you can get past that and plan your days accordingly, you can have a great visit at a better price point. Choose Your Hotel Carefully
The great thing about Disney is that there are resorts for every budget. Those looking to keep costs as low as possible will likely want to stay at the “value” hotels. You can also stay in a non-Disney hotel, but it’s important to factor in the cost of transportation. Those staying at Disney resorts have access to free parking at the parks as well as free shuttles that run about every 20 minutes. The $286 average rate for Disney’s cheapest rooms still exceeds the average hotel room rate off-property. According to Visit Orlando’s 2022 Travel Industry Indicators, Orlando’s average daily room rate is just $186.49, about 35% less than the cheapest room at a Disney resort. Average Cost to Go to Disney World Per Person, Per Day
If you don’t plan the trip to Disney World cost, it can spoil your vacation. Here’s what you can expect to spend per person, per day for a theme park ticket, hotel room, and meal, based on travel style. The average cost to go to Disney World will vary depending on the experience you want:
Value | Moderate | Deluxe | |
---|---|---|---|
1-day, 1-park theme park ticket | $160 | $175 | $175 |
1-night hotel room (Saturday night) | $286 | $366 | $877 |
Individual meal | $19 | $59 | $93 |
Average Cost of a Disney Vacation for a Family of 4
When planning a trip with your family, it’s crucial to estimate the average cost to go to Disney World. Here’s the breakdown based on travel style and length of stay:
1 night | 3 nights | 7 nights | |
Value | $1,227 | $2,783 | $6,463 |
Moderate | $1,525 | $3,636 | $8,912 |
Deluxe | $2,332 | $6,075 | $15,559 |
Set a Limit on Souvenirs
Souvenir shops are an easy way to quickly bust your budget. Try to avoid spending too much time in the gift shops, where the temptation can be hard to resist – or, set a limit for how much each person can spend on souvenirs per day or throughout the vacation. Disney World Food Costs
The trip to Disney World cost also includes meals. Average meal prices depend on the restaurant type. The average cost to go to Disney World for food alone can add up quickly:
Restaurant Pricing Tier | Average Cost Per Person, Per Meal (Including Tax & Tip) |
Value (Counter service or cart) | $19 |
Moderate (Table service with waitstaff, casual restaurant) | $59 |
Deluxe (Table service with waitstaff, fancy restaurant) | $93 |

How Families Can Do Disney World on a Budget
A family of four should expect to spend a minimum of $6,000 for seven nights at Walt Disney World, including food, hotel, theme park tickets, and add-ons. But a trip to Disney World cost can be reduced. Here’s how:
Cut back on theme park days
Book Disney Good Neighbor Hotels, which are family resorts near Disney World that are generally more budget-friendly.
Seek Disney World family vacation packages, many of which are offered through Good Neighbor hotels.
Conclusion with A Recent Personal Example
Every so often I get someone arguing with me about these numbers even though they’re pretty clearly laid out in this post. So I want to also add a real example from a recent trip. This trip was:
2 adults, 1 child
3 Nights over Veterans Day weekend 2024
A split stay at Wilderness Lodge (1 night) and Art of Animation (2 nights)
A family visit to Mickey’s Very Merry Christmas Party and a solo visit to Jollywood Nights
We have annual passes, so I’m adding $2,097.42 for the cost of four days (we arrived early and left late) of tickets. With ticket costs, the total trip to Disney World cost was $6,914.15. That was for everything from the second we left home until the second we returned home.
That puts the trip between my baseline estimate for a family of 3 and my expensive estimate for a family of 3. This trip varied from the baseline trip in a lot of ways, but you can hopefully at least see that as eye-popping as these numbers might look, they’re in the ballpark.
